El Salvador Aid Fight Sparks Senate House Debate

Democratic leaders vow quick action to block Reagan’s 110 million aid package for El Salvador citing reprogramming limits. They push votes in Foreign Relations and Appropriations to deny shifting 60 million, while some Republicans urge careful speedy consideration of urgent aid needs.

Workers at Lenin Shipyard Demand Solidarity Return

In Gdansk workers demand reinstatement of the Solidarity union and protest outside the Lenin shipyard. An open letter urges legalization of Solidarity and an end to reprisals while condemning martial law as ineffective.

Aiken Hosts Triple Crown and Trials Weekend Events

Saturday at 1 30 p m the Triple Crown Aiken sulky races take place at the Aiken Mile Track with general admission three dollars and children under 12 one dollar sponsored by Aiken County Shrine Club. The Aiken Trials follow on March 19 at 2 p m at the Aiken Training Track with advance tickets four dollars and children under 12 two dollars and race day five dollars and two dollars. The Aiken Hunt Meet on March 26 at 1 30 p m at Clark Field offers guarantors four tickets tent party luncheon and preferred parking for 150 and rail side parking 25 subscribers 50 includes two adult tickets and rail side parking additional tickets five dollars each general advance admission three dollars adults two dollars children under 12 race day admission four dollars adults.

Memos Hint EPA Favored Reactor EIS in L-Reactor Case

In Columbia, attorney Jacob Scherr of the NRDC says EPA memos urged a detailed environmental impact study before restarting Savannah River Plant's L-Reactor. The suit, joined by South Carolina, challenges DOE and argues a top EPA political decision avoided the study.

Idaho Lobbying Grows as federal reactor site fight narrows

Idaho citizens press to land a four billion dollar federal reactor project set to boost weapons material production. SRP Idaho Falls and Hanford in Washington are competing with the National Engineering Laboratory in Idaho Falls for site selection. A DOE panel favored SRP, but legal challenges and protests cloud the choice.
